Education has traditionally been measured through marks, grades, examinations, and certificates. Students attend classes, complete assignments, prepare for tests, and receive results that indicate their academic performance. While these measurements remain important, the way learners engage with education is gradually expanding. With the growth of digital learning platforms, interactive quizzes, and technology-enabled education, students are discovering new ways to understand their progress. One emerging idea is the use of game-inspired learning systems, where students can track their educational achievements through experience points, levels, challenges, and milestones.
Imagine a student opening a learning platform after completing a quiz. Instead of seeing only a score, the student also discovers that they have earned experience points, unlocked a new learning level, or made progress toward a practical skill achievement. The experience creates a different way of viewing education. Learning becomes something that students can monitor over time, with each completed activity contributing to a broader journey. This does not mean education should become a game in every situation, but game-inspired features can offer additional ways to encourage participation, revision, and goal-setting.
For students in India, where academic performance and career preparation are often closely connected, this approach may be particularly relevant. Learners are increasingly exploring online courses, skill development programs, quizzes, and internships alongside their formal education. They want to understand not only what they have studied but also how much they have practised, which skills they have developed, and what opportunities they can pursue next. A learning progress system inspired by experience points could help make these activities more visible and organized.
EasyShiksha, with its focus on online courses, certificates, quizzes, and internship opportunities, provides a relevant context for discussing this transformation. By connecting learning activities with progress tracking and practical development, an educational platform can encourage students to participate more actively in their learning journey. The concept of learning XP can be explored as a way to represent progress, motivate consistent practice, and help students recognize achievements beyond examination results.
However, game-inspired education should be designed thoughtfully. Experience points do not automatically measure understanding, and collecting points should not become more important than learning. A successful approach needs to balance engagement with meaningful educational outcomes. For many students, progress has traditionally been associated with examination results. A learner completes a semester, receives marks, and compares the outcome with previous academic performance. These results can provide useful information about achievement in a particular assessment, but they may not capture every aspect of a student's learning journey.
A student may spend several weeks learning a programming language, practising difficult concepts, and solving problems without receiving a formal examination result during that period. Another student may improve communication skills through repeated presentations, while a different learner develops design abilities by completing small creative projects. These forms of progress can be meaningful even when they are not immediately reflected in academic grades.
Digital learning platforms offer opportunities to make such activities more visible. Students can complete quizzes, track course progress, record achievements, and explore additional learning activities. When these features are organized into a structured system, learners may find it easier to understand what they have accomplished and what they want to work on next.
The idea of experience points introduces a game-inspired method of representing this progress. In many games, players earn XP by completing tasks, overcoming challenges, or reaching milestones. In an educational environment, a similar system could assign progress indicators to activities such as completing a lesson, achieving a learning objective, finishing a practice assignment, or participating in an internship-related task.
The meaning of XP in education would be different from its meaning in a game. It should represent participation or progress in defined learning activities rather than serve as a complete measure of intelligence, knowledge, or professional ability. Students could use the system to organize their learning journey, while teachers and platforms would need to ensure that the underlying activities remain meaningful.

Learning XP, or experience points, is a game-inspired concept that can be adapted to educational activities. In a learning platform, XP could represent progress associated with completing specific tasks or reaching defined milestones. The system might award points for finishing a lesson, completing a quiz, submitting a practical assignment, or achieving a course-related objective.
For example, a beginner studying digital marketing could receive a progress indicator after completing an introductory lesson. Completing a related quiz might contribute additional XP, while finishing a practical content-planning assignment could unlock a new milestone. The student would be able to see how different learning activities contribute to progress within the course.
The exact point system would depend on the educational platform and the learning objectives. A simple lesson completion might be recorded differently from a practical project that requires substantial effort. However, assigning more points to a task does not automatically mean that the task is more educationally valuable. The system should be designed to reflect meaningful milestones rather than encourage students to complete activities merely to accumulate numbers.
A well-designed XP system could include different categories of progress. Course completion might represent foundational learning, quiz performance could indicate knowledge checks, and project completion could represent practical application. Internship-related achievements could be recorded separately to distinguish professional exposure from online course participation.
The distinction between different achievement types is important because students need to understand what their progress actually represents. Completing ten introductory lessons is not the same as demonstrating proficiency in a professional skill. A transparent platform can help learners interpret their achievements accurately.

Games often provide players with clear objectives, immediate feedback, visible progress, and achievable challenges. These features can make activities feel more structured and encourage participants to continue engaging with them. Educational platforms may adapt selected game-inspired features to create learning experiences that feel more interactive.
For students, a visible progress system can make a large learning goal appear more manageable. Completing an entire course may seem difficult when viewed as one major task. Breaking the journey into lessons, quizzes, assignments, and milestones can help learners focus on smaller achievements.
Consider a student beginning a course in Python programming. The learner may initially feel uncertain about variables, functions, and logical problem-solving. A structured learning system could present a sequence of manageable activities, allowing the student to complete introductory lessons and practise basic exercises before moving toward more complex concepts.
Progress indicators may help the student recognize that learning is taking place gradually. Completing a quiz or solving a practice problem can provide a sense of achievement, particularly when the learner has been working through a difficult topic.
However, game-inspired features do not affect every student in the same way. Some learners may find points and levels motivating, while others may prefer independent study, detailed feedback, or practical assignments without game-like elements. Educational platforms should offer learning experiences that support different preferences and avoid assuming that gamification is universally effective.
The value of game-inspired design depends on how it is used. A progress bar that encourages students to complete lessons thoughtfully may be useful. A system that rewards rapid completion without considering understanding may create unintended incentives.

Quizzes are a common feature of online education because they allow students to review concepts and check their understanding. A quiz score can provide information about performance in a particular set of questions, but a single score may not show the full progression of a learner.
For example, a student studying cybersecurity may complete an introductory quiz on passwords, phishing, and basic security concepts. After reviewing the material, the learner may take another quiz and improve their score. This progression can help the student identify areas where revision has been useful.
An XP-based system could record quiz participation and connect it with broader learning milestones. Completing a quiz might contribute to course progress, while successfully demonstrating a particular learning objective could unlock a relevant achievement. The exact approach should depend on the educational purpose of the assessment.
It is important to distinguish between quiz completion and genuine understanding. A student who answers questions correctly may have developed useful knowledge, but the result does not necessarily demonstrate the ability to apply that knowledge in a practical setting. For this reason, quizzes should be combined with other learning activities when the course objectives require practical skills.
A programming course might include quizzes on syntax and concepts alongside coding exercises. A digital marketing course could combine knowledge checks with sample content planning. A finance course may use quizzes to reinforce terminology while offering practical exercises involving sample financial information.

Levels are another feature commonly associated with games. Players may move from beginner to advanced stages as they complete tasks and develop abilities. In education, levels can be adapted to represent learning progression when they are based on clear and appropriate criteria.
A beginner-level course might introduce foundational concepts, while a more advanced level could involve applying those concepts to practical problems. For instance, a student studying web development could begin with basic HTML and CSS before exploring responsive design, JavaScript, and more complex projects.
An educational level system should not imply that every learner progresses at the same speed. Students have different backgrounds, learning preferences, and available time. Some may understand a concept quickly, while others require additional practice and revision. Levels should therefore function as flexible indicators of progress rather than rigid judgments about a student's ability.
The criteria for advancing should also be transparent. Completing a certain number of lessons may indicate participation, while demonstrating a defined skill through an assignment may provide stronger evidence of practical understanding. These achievements should be distinguished so that students know what each level represents.
For example, an introductory learning level in digital marketing might involve understanding basic terminology and completing foundational quizzes. A practical learning level could involve preparing a sample content plan or conducting a supervised exercise. An advanced level might require a more complex project, depending on the course design.

Learning a new subject can feel overwhelming when students focus only on a distant goal. A learner may want to become a programmer, digital marketer, data analyst, or finance professional, but the skills required for these roles can take time to develop. Breaking the learning journey into smaller milestones can make the process easier to understand.
Small achievements can help students recognize their progress. Completing a lesson, solving a difficult problem, or finishing a practical assignment may provide evidence that the learner is moving forward. These milestones can support motivation, particularly when the student is working through a challenging subject.
Game-inspired systems often use visible feedback to show progress. In education, a similar approach could allow students to see how individual activities contribute to their broader learning goals. The progress indicator may be a simple bar, a milestone record, or an XP total.
However, motivation should not depend entirely on external rewards. Students also benefit from understanding why a subject matters, developing curiosity, and recognizing the practical value of their knowledge. If a learner focuses only on earning points, they may become less interested in activities that are difficult but educationally important.
A thoughtful learning platform can balance external feedback with opportunities for reflection. After completing a quiz, students might be encouraged to revisit incorrect answers. After finishing a project, they could review what they learned and identify areas for improvement.

Consistency is an important part of skill development. Students may understand a concept during one study session but require repeated practice to use it confidently. Regular engagement with learning material can help learners revisit information, identify weaknesses, and build familiarity with new skills.
An XP-based system could encourage students to return to their courses and complete manageable activities over time. Instead of attempting to finish an entire course in one sitting, a learner might set aside regular study periods to complete lessons, take quizzes, and work on practical assignments.
For example, a student learning programming could practise for a short period each day or several times a week, depending on their schedule. One session might involve reviewing a concept, while another could focus on solving exercises. The progress record would show the activities completed over time.
The usefulness of such a system depends on how it rewards learning behavior. If points are awarded only for speed or the number of completed activities, students may rush through content. A more thoughtful system could recognize meaningful milestones, revision, project completion, or improvement.
Students should also have the freedom to learn at different speeds. Academic schedules, personal responsibilities, and varying levels of difficulty can affect how frequently a learner studies. A platform should avoid making students feel that missing a daily target means they have failed.

A learning progress system becomes more meaningful when it includes opportunities for practical application. Students may complete lessons and quizzes, but practical projects can help them understand how knowledge is used in specific situations.
Consider a student studying data science. The learner might complete introductory lessons on data types, basic statistics, and data visualization. Quizzes could reinforce the concepts, while a small project could involve organizing a sample dataset and creating a simple chart.
An XP system could record the completion of these different activities, but the platform should clearly distinguish between them. Completing a quiz demonstrates participation and performance in a knowledge assessment. Completing a project indicates that the student has worked through a practical task. Neither achievement alone should be treated as a complete measure of professional competence.
Project milestones could be designed around specific learning objectives. A beginner might receive recognition for completing a simple task, while a more advanced learner could work toward a larger project involving multiple concepts. The criteria should be appropriate to the course and explained clearly.

As students participate in different learning activities, they may benefit from having a centralized record of their educational progress. A digital learning profile can bring together courses, quizzes, projects, achievements, and relevant internship experiences.
A learning profile that includes XP-based progress could help students visualize their development across different subjects. For example, a learner interested in artificial intelligence might track foundational courses, quiz performance, practical projects, and internship-related learning. Another student exploring communication could document courses, presentations, and relevant assignments.
The structure of the profile matters. Students should be able to distinguish between course completion, quiz results, practical projects, and professional exposure. This makes the record more informative and reduces the risk of treating all achievements as equivalent.
A learning profile can also help students identify areas where they want to improve. A learner may have completed several courses but have limited practical experience. Another student may have strong technical skills but need additional communication practice. A progress record can encourage learners to reflect on these differences.

Game-inspired learning can increase engagement, but it should not replace educational assessment. Points, levels, and badges can provide feedback about activity, yet they do not automatically demonstrate whether students understand concepts or can apply skills effectively.
For example, a student may complete a large number of lessons and quizzes but still struggle to solve an independent programming problem. Another learner may earn fewer points because they study more slowly but develop a stronger understanding of the subject. A numerical ranking alone would not accurately represent these differences.
Educational platforms should therefore use XP carefully. The system can recognize progress and participation while assessments evaluate learning outcomes through suitable methods. These methods may include quizzes, assignments, practical projects, presentations, and other forms of evaluation.
A student studying accounting, for instance, may need to demonstrate an understanding of accounting concepts and complete practical exercises. A learner pursuing programming may need to write and explain code. A communication course may involve presentations or written assignments. The appropriate assessment depends on the subject and learning objectives.

Gamification involves applying selected game-inspired elements to non-game activities. In education, these elements may include points, badges, levels, challenges, progress bars, and achievement systems. When used thoughtfully, they can support engagement and make learning activities more interactive.
However, gamification is not automatically effective in every educational context. Students may respond differently to rewards, competition, and progress indicators. Some learners may become motivated by visible milestones, while others may find excessive point tracking distracting or stressful.
A responsible approach focuses on educational outcomes. Points should be connected to meaningful activities, and students should understand what achievements represent. The system should avoid encouraging unhealthy competition or suggesting that learners who accumulate fewer points are less capable.
Privacy and data transparency are also important considerations. If a platform records student progress, it should communicate how the information is used and provide appropriate protections. Learning records should be designed to support students rather than create unnecessary pressure.
